Located in the quiet corner of Orton, a small village on the Cumbrian edge of the Yorkshire Dales National Park, Linden Barn was renovated in 2020 and is now a cosy house offering accommodation for up to six guests. At the heart of the house is the kitchen and living area with underfloor heating and a wood burning stove providing a warm welcome to walkers and cyclists on even the wettest of days. Indeed, there is also a large utility room to store boots and coats upon returning from walks. Linden Barn has two double rooms each with a king-size bed and one twin-bedded room. The ground floor double bedroom has an en-suite shower room and the two further bedrooms are on the first floor, where there is also a family bathroom and sitting area with stunning far-reaching views.

If the weather is fine, the sliding doors open onto an outdoor seating area with views over the owners' paddock to the Howgill Fells. Buzzards are often seen overhead, you may hear the Curlews during their breeding season and Tawny Owls at night. Guests might even be lucky enough to see Red Squirrels.

Orton was described by Wainwright as one of Westmorland’s loveliest villages and surrounded by rolling countryside views, it's easy to see why. There is a small General Store, Post Office and a warm and welcoming pub.

Kennedy’s Fine Chocolate Factory and Orton Scar Café are essential stops for walkers and non- walkers alike. The surrounding area has rugged limestone scenery, meadows and a network of footpaths and bridleways ideal for walkers of all levels, cyclists, birdwatchers and wildflower enthusiasts or those just looking for a quiet spot to get away. Further afield, the fells of the Eastern Lake District can be easily accessed via Penrith or Shap. The Yorkshire Dales are a short drive in the opposite direction.
